U.S. to back $2 billion in loanguarantees for Ukraine

WASHINGTON TueJan 13,

(Reuters) -The United States plans to provide up to $2 billion in loan guarantees toUkraine this year, the U.S. Treasury said on Tuesday, as part of a broaderinternational package to stave off bankruptcy.

Like othermajor donors to the country, Treasury said the guarantees would be contingenton the former Soviet republic remaining on track to meet the conditions of itsloan program from the International Monetary Fund. IMF officials are in Kievthis week to resume negotiations on the package, currently worth $17 billion.

Ukraine'sgovernment hopes the IMF's visit will lead to a bigger aid program as itseconomy has been pushed close to bankruptcy by a pro-Russian separatist war inthe east and the government faces huge debt repayments.
